Aspects
- class aws_cdk.core.Aspects(*args: Any, **kwargs)
- Bases: - object- Aspects can be applied to CDK tree scopes and can operate on the tree before synthesis. - ExampleMetadata:
- nofixture infused 
 - Example: - import aws_cdk.core as cdk from constructs import Construct, IConstruct class MyAspect(cdk.IAspect): def visit(self, node): if node instanceof cdk.CfnResource && node.cfn_resource_type == "Foo::Bar": self.error(node, "we do not want a Foo::Bar resource") def error(self, node, message): cdk.Annotations.of(node).add_error(message) class MyStack(cdk.Stack): def __init__(self, scope, id): super().__init__(scope, id) stack = cdk.Stack() cdk.CfnResource(stack, "Foo", type="Foo::Bar", properties={ "Fred": "Thud" } ) cdk.Aspects.of(stack).add(MyAspect()) - Methods - add(aspect)
- Adds an aspect to apply this scope before synthesis. - Parameters:
- aspect ( - IAspect) – The aspect to add.
- Return type:
- None
 
 - Attributes - aspects
- The list of aspects which were directly applied on this scope. 
 - Static Methods - classmethod of(scope)
- Returns the - Aspectsobject associated with a construct scope.- Parameters:
- scope ( - IConstruct) – The scope for which these aspects will apply.
